Module: TestAfterCommit

Defined in:
lib/test_after_commit.rb,
lib/test_after_commit/version.rb

Constant Summary collapse

VERSION =
'0.4.2'

Class Attribute Summary collapse

Class Method Summary collapse

Class Attribute Details

.enabledObject

Returns the value of attribute enabled.



6
7
8
# File 'lib/test_after_commit.rb', line 6

def enabled
  @enabled
end

Class Method Details

.with_commits(value = true) ⇒ Object



8
9
10
11
12
13
14
# File 'lib/test_after_commit.rb', line 8

def with_commits(value = true)
  old = enabled
  self.enabled = value
  yield
ensure
  self.enabled = old
end